I applied online. The process took 4 weeks. I interviewed at Shawmut Design and Construction in Mar 2014
Interview
Applied online and was emailed requesting a phone interview. Honestly, the phone interview was the most difficult part of the hiring process. The HR employee asked me about my experiences and some behavioral questions. I was then invited to come Interview at the one of the offices. First I met with a employee in the CMST program. He just shared his experience with the company and asked a few questions. Then a mid-level employee in the estimating department came in and asked a few questions and shared her experience with me as well. I then met with a senior level employee.
Seems like a great company heading in the right direction.

I applied online. The process took 2 weeks. I interviewed at Shawmut Design and Construction (New York, NY) in Jan 2012
Interview
I initially did an over the phone interview with HQ in Boston. It went great, I answered all the questions with the best possible answers. Was given an onsite interview the following week. I Met with three workers individually. First a lower level employee, then a mid level employee and finally a department Manager. I was amazed at the professionalism and enthusiasm of every employee I met with. Total time of the interviews was approximately 2 hours. Walked out of the office assured I would get the job. Received a call one week later exactly telling me that I had the job.
